Jak přenést nebo převzít role FSMO služby Active Directory pomocí PowerShellu
Summary: V tomto článku se dozvíte, jak přenést nebo převzít role FSMO (Flexible Single Mstr Operations) pomocí příkazu PowerShellu Move-ADDirectoryServerOperationMasterRo.
This article applies to
This article does not apply to
This article is not tied to any specific product.
Not all product versions are identified in this article.
Instructions
Existuje několik způsobů, jak přesunout role FSMO mezi řadiči domény Active Directory, grafickými konzolami AD,
Rutina Move-ADDirectoryServerMstrOperationRole
slouží k přenosu nebo převzetí rolí FSMO. Dá se spustit přímo na řadiči domény nebo na serveru nebo pracovní stanici připojené k doméně s nainstalovaným modulem PowerShellu služby ActiveDirectory . Existují dva důležité parametry, které musí být zadány tomuto příkazu, Identity a OperationMasterRole.
Parametr Identity určuje cílový řadič domény – tj. řadič domény, do kterého se role nebo role přesouvají. (Není nutné zadávat zdrojový řadič domény, protože informace o držiteli role jsou uloženy ve službě AD.) Obvykle se jedná o název hostitele cílového řadiče domény, ale může se jednat také o plně kvalifikovaný název domény, rozlišující název nebo identifikátor GUID.
Parametr OperationMasterRole určuje, které role nebo role se přesouvají. Možné hodnoty tohoto parametru jsou PDCEmulator, RIDMaster, InfrastructureMaster, SchemaMaster a DomainNamingMaster, ale pro každou z nich existují také číselné zkratky:
Zde se projeví rychlost a efektivita PowerShellu. Pokud chcete přenést všech pět rolí FSMO na řadič domény s názvem NewDC, spusťte tuto rutinu:
Chcete-li převzít role FSMO, což by mělo být provedeno pouze v případě, že je stávající držitel role trvale offline, přidejte do rutiny parametr -Force . Použijeme-li výše uvedený příklad, pokud by všech pět rolí držel řadič domény, který byl trvale offline, mohly by být všechny zachyceny v NewDC takto:
Toto video ukazuje proces: Přenos a převzetí rolí FSMO v PowerShellu
ntdsutil a PowerShell. Při přenosu nebo převzetí více rolí najednou je PowerShell pravděpodobně nejrychlejší a nejjednodušší metodou.
Rutina Move-ADDirectoryServerMstrOperationRole
Parametr Identity určuje cílový řadič domény – tj. řadič domény, do kterého se role nebo role přesouvají. (Není nutné zadávat zdrojový řadič domény, protože informace o držiteli role jsou uloženy ve službě AD.) Obvykle se jedná o název hostitele cílového řadiče domény, ale může se jednat také o plně kvalifikovaný název domény, rozlišující název nebo identifikátor GUID.
Parametr OperationMasterRole určuje, které role nebo role se přesouvají. Možné hodnoty tohoto parametru jsou PDCEmulator, RIDMaster, InfrastructureMaster, SchemaMaster a DomainNamingMaster, ale pro každou z nich existují také číselné zkratky:
0: PDCEmulator
1: RIDMaster
2: InfrastructureMaster
3: SchemaMaster
4: DomainNamingMaster (Název_domény)
1: RIDMaster
2: InfrastructureMaster
3: SchemaMaster
4: DomainNamingMaster (Název_domény)
Zde se projeví rychlost a efektivita PowerShellu. Pokud chcete přenést všech pět rolí FSMO na řadič domény s názvem NewDC, spusťte tuto rutinu:
Move-ADDirectoryServerOperationMasterRole -Identity NewDC -OperationMasterRole 0,1,2,3,4PowerShell ve výchozím nastavení vyzve k potvrzení každé role, ale existuje možnost Ano všem .
Chcete-li převzít role FSMO, což by mělo být provedeno pouze v případě, že je stávající držitel role trvale offline, přidejte do rutiny parametr -Force . Použijeme-li výše uvedený příklad, pokud by všech pět rolí držel řadič domény, který byl trvale offline, mohly by být všechny zachyceny v NewDC takto:
Move-ADDirectoryServerOperationMasterRole -Identity NewDC -OperationMasterRole 0,1,2,3,4 -ForceJak vidíte, jediným rozdílem mezi tímto a předchozím příkazem je parametr -Force . Zobrazí se výzva pro každou roli, jak je uvedeno výše. Převzetí rolí trvá déle než přenesení rolí, protože před převzetím rolí dojde k pokusu o normální přenos všech rolí. Za předpokladu, že držitel role nereaguje, musí před zabavením vypršet časový limit. Z tohoto důvodu trvá obsazení všech pěti rolí tímto způsobem několik minut.
Toto video ukazuje proces: Přenos a převzetí rolí FSMO v PowerShellu
Délka: 06:02
Skryté titulky jsou k dispozici ve více jazycích. Kliknutím na ikonu CC změníte jazyk titulků.
Affected Products
Microsoft Windows Server 2016, Microsoft Windows Server 2019, Microsoft Windows Server 2022, Microsoft Windows 2012 Server, Microsoft Windows 2012 Server R2Article Properties
Article Number: 000193715
Article Type: How To
Last Modified: 10 Mar 2025
Version: 10
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.